Falling In Love With My Best Friend
It was a casual July evening
I was with my bestie, Jake.
There was a tiny campfire, showing our faces
he wore a Hawaiian shirt
I had a pink orchid in my hair
I did not mean to fall in love with him,
but how could I not?
When Jake ook out the ukulele and sang, I was a goner
His hazel eyes had a sparkle I had never seen before
Had it been there all along?
Is this something I had missed for the past six years?
It mattered not now
It was summer
We were on a Hawaiian beach
A terrific place to fall deeply in love
with my best friend
Shangri-la
